PM: Bartolome Island

Bartholome is an extinct volcano with a variety of red, orange, black, and even green volcanic formations. It is home to the famous Pinnacle Rock. A stairwell leads to the volcano's summit, which offers one of the best views of the islands. The beach is ideal for snorkeling and possible Galapagos penguin sightings.

Rabida Island & Puerto Egas

AM: Rabida Island

Rabida Island (Jervis) is a great snorkeling spot and one of the archipelago's most colorful and volcanically diverse islands. Its famous maroon sandy beach and stunning lookouts provide breathtaking scenery. The island is a birdwatcher's paradise. Some of the rarest species, such as nine varieties of finches, large-billed flycatchers, Galapagos hawks, and brown pelicans, are plentiful.

PM: Puerto Egas

Egas Port, also known as James Bay, is home to the curious Galapagos hawks and the quick-footed Galapagos lava lizards. The trail leads to a coastline with beautiful tide pools and fauna-filled grottos. The Galapagos fur sea lions sunbathe here. This is also an excellent snorkeling location

Genovesa Island

AM: Darwin Bay

This white sand coral beach leads to a half-mile (0.75km) trail that winds through mangroves teeming with land birds. Here you can see Nazca boobies, red-footed boobies, and swallow-tailed gulls. Tidal pools with playful sea lions can be found further down the path. At the end, there is a breathtaking view from a cliff.

PM: El Barranco

El Barranco's steep, rocky paths, also known as Prince Phillip's Steps, lead up to a high cliff-face. From here, you can enjoy a spectacular view. Palo santo vegetation can also be found here, as well as red-footed boobies, short-eared lava owls, Galapagos swallows, and Galapagos doves.

Mosquera islet & Tortoise breeding center

AM: Mosquera islet

This reef of rocks and coral (the result of an uprising) is only 160 meters across at its narrowest point, located between the islands of Baltra and North Seymour. This island is home to many shorebirds and has one of the largest populations of sea lions. There have been reports of orcas feeding on sea lions at this location on occasion.

PM: Tortoise breeding center

The Charles Darwin Research Station is home to turtles ranging from 3-inches (new hatchlings) to 4-feet long. Subspecies of turtles interact with one another and many of the older turtles are accustomed to humans stretching out their heads for a photo opportunity. The babies are kept until they reach the age of four and are strong enough to survive on their own.

Depart Galapagos Islands

AM: North Seymour Island

North Seymour Island is teeming with Galapagos sea lions, blue-footed boobies, and magnificent frigatebirds. The island was formed by a series of submarine lava flows with sediment layers that were uplifted by tectonic activity. The island is characterized by its arid vegetation zone.

Horizon Trimaran

Horizon Trimaran

The modern M/T Horizon Trimaran is a spacious and comfortable luxury trimaran, the only trimaran currently sailing in Galapagos waters. Carrying a maximum of only 16 passengers, the Horizon features 8 staterooms, each with private balcony. On board there is a Jacuzzi and the ship carries kayaks, snorkelling equipment and wetsuits for use by its passengers. The vessel offers a range of 4, 5 and 8-day itineraries around the Galapagos Islands, all accompanied by a bilingual naturalist guide who will share their extensive knowledge on the flora and fauna of the region. As well as a captain and cruise director you will be well taken care of by the other crew members onboard. The 3 hulls of the trimaran provide stability and faster navigation compared with other vessels.
